Output 03426eaa13fa765aac9f0a471e67af64f5958c10424ef50bb68ca8a9e445a3f8:324

value
17831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0789b64156d2dbb23701675d9099ca24bc9c04 OP_EQUAL
address
3L7FT3ByD3x7N6srSNmLX3KPJUP8jJcBZ5
transaction
03426eaa13fa765aac9f0a471e67af64f5958c10424ef50bb68ca8a9e445a3f8
spent
true